Syracuse Chiefs Weekly Update

June 9th -

Chiefs lose to Rochester 9-8- Corey Paterson, Pete Orr, Corey Kasto, Brad Eldred, and Marcos Yepez all have 2 hits.

Sauuuuuuuuul pitches last 3 innings giving up 1 run but gets the loss.

June12th- Double header-

Game 1 - Chiefs win both against Red Sox 4-1. Mock out duals Smoltz. Mock goes 6 innings giving up 2 hits and a run and strikes out seven. Corey Patterson's double broke the game open. Kasto also homers off Smoltz.

Game 2- JD Martin pitches very effective giving up 1 run in 6.2 innings. He scattered 5 hits to lower his ERA to 2.45.

Sauuuuuuul gets the one out save. J-Max homered.

June 13th -

6-2 loss to the Pawtucket Sawx-  J-Max went 3-4 with a homer. Mike O'Connor pitches 3.2 innings giving up 4 for the loss.

June 14th -

Chiefs lose 15-5 - Scott Olsen makes the start going three innings giving up 3. Sauuuuuuuuul comes in and goes 2.2 innings giving up 8 runs. Ouch! Ryan Langerhans goes 3-4 with two RBIs

June 15th-

Split double header with Buffalo(Mets)

Game 1- Colin Balester goes 6 innings giving up just 2 runs. Tyler Clippard comes in for the save and Chiefs win 4-2. His ERA is now 0.98. The Chiefs score 2 in the eighth for the win.

Game 2 - Horacio Ramirez lasts two innings and gives up one run. Jorge Sosa pitched the final five innings giving up 2 runs on seven hits. Chiefs lose 3-2. Also, who knew Wily Mo Pena is a Met.

- J- Max with a good hitting week and Garret Mock looks dominant vs PawSOX
